Telangana Govt Moves To Supreme Court On BC Reservations
Delhi/Hyderabad, Oct 14 (Maxim News) Telangana BC Reservation has been mentioned in the Supreme Court. The Telangana government has mentioned the petition for 42 percent reservation in the Supreme Court. The state government’s lawyers have mentioned it to the Supreme Court Registrar.
The lawyers have requested that it be taken up for hearing on Thursday (16th of this month) or Friday (17th of this month). The Registrar has stated that it will be listed with the permission of the Chief Justice. In this order, the BC reservation petition is likely to come up for hearing before the Supreme Court on Thursday or Friday.

Meanwhile.. It is known that the Telangana High Court has stayed the GO 9 given on BC reservations. The Telangana government has challenged this in the Supreme Court. The petition stated that the stay given by the High Court on 42 percent GO to BCs should be lifted.
The Telangana government has requested that the inquiry be taken up quickly.. and that the inquiry should be held this week itself. The petition stated that the notification for the local body elections has been issued, and everyone is filing nominations.. In this order, a decision should be made on the reservations.
The stay imposed by the Telangana High Court on GO No. 9 should be lifted. The government said that the High Court had stayed these reservations without fully hearing their arguments, that the detailed details of the BCs were collected through the caste census, and that the percentage of reservations was decided after the commission’s study.
The government stated in its petition that there are more than 56 percent BCs in Telangana and that 42 percent reservation was allocated according to the population ratio. (Maxim News)
